Immigrants from Hong Kong vs Cherokee Unemployment Among Ages 60 to 64 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 240,391,172 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Hong Kong and unemployment rate among population between the ages 60 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.360 and weighted average of 5.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 419,901,467 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Cherokee and unemployment rate among population between the ages 60 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.523 and weighted average of 4.9%, a difference of 5.2%.
